Recognizing the Art Behind Metal Stamping
At its core, metal stamping is the process of transforming level steel sheets into particular forms via force and precision. This isn't a one-size-fits-all operation; it includes numerous techniques like bending, punching, creating, and embossing-- each chosen for the task available. Every bend and cut is implemented with incredible accuracy, directed by the devices and passes away crafted for the work.
This procedure requires greater than simply machines-- it requires a knowledgeable group and progressed modern technology. The artistry of tool and die shops hinge on developing custom passes away that permit the exact recreation of components, to the tiniest detail. Whether creating easy brackets or complicated automobile components, precision is non-negotiable.
Just How Metal Stamping Powers Modern Living
Look around your home or office and you'll locate plenty of items brought to life by metal stamping. The structural frame of your dishwashing machine, the ports in your smartphone, the brace holding your auto's control panel-- all these parts owe their existence to stamped steel.
In the automobile world, the need for toughness and consistency makes progressive die stamping a favored. This method entails a collection of stations, each executing a special function as the steel advancements via the press. It's suitable for high-volume runs and guarantees each item satisfies exacting criteria.
However it does not stop with autos. In the medical field, where integrity can be a matter of necessity, metal stamping is used to craft surgical devices and gadget parts. In the aerospace industry, marked parts have to withstand severe problems while meeting tight resistances. The same is true in consumer electronic devices, where space-saving, high-functionality designs ask for stamped steel components that are both light-weight and strong.
Precision, Speed, and Reliability: Why Metal Stamping Matters
So why has metal stamping end up being such a best method across a lot of markets? Most importantly: speed. Once the passes away are set up, thousands of similar components can be created with little variant. This degree of repeatability is vital when uniformity issues.
After that there's the inquiry of cost-effectiveness. Traditional machining might take longer and involve more material waste. But stamping, specifically when made with progressive die modern technology, maintains manufacturing scooting and successfully. It's one of the most intelligent means to fulfill high-volume production objectives without giving up top quality.
The integrity of this procedure likewise can't be overstated. When you're producing thousands-- or even millions-- of parts, a tiny imperfection can come to be a large issue. That's why partnering with a knowledgeable tool and die company is so necessary. The ideal team guarantees every part is made to spec, every time.
